Man charged with weapons offence in Harmanjit Singh death

The man charged in the death of Hamilton teen Harmanjit Singh is suspected of several weapons offences, police say.

In February, Dashminder Deol, 37, was arrested and charged with manslaughter and offering an indignity to human remains.

On Thursday, he, as well as Gurminder Deol, 34, were charged with a number of weapons charges dating back to a Nov. 6, 2014 search of a Stoney Creek home found a pair of unlawfully possessed firearms and ammunition.

Police cautioned that "there has been no evidence obtained to believe that the firearms had played any role in the disappearance or death of Harmanjit Singh," in a press release.

Singh's body was found floating in a flood basin in Stoney Creek in late November.

Previously, Det. Sgt. Joe Stewart of the homicide unit would not reveal how Singh died, saying that it would come out in the court system. "But I do not believe there was an intent to kill Singh in this incident," he said in late February when charges of manslaughter and offering an indignity to human remains were laid against Deol. 

Singh, 19, disappeared on Oct. 27 after spending time at a friend's home on the east Mountain the night before. Police subsequently searched the home as part of the investigation. 

According to the Hamilton Spectator, Deol lived in the home. Stewart would not confirm that police had searched Deol's home, only saying officers had searched "various places as well as a vehicle."
